Cala Galdana is a picturesque coastal resort located on the south coast of Menorca, one of the Balearic Islands in Spain. Known for its stunning natural beauty, Cala Galdana is nestled between high cliffs and surrounded by lush pine forests, creating a serene and idyllic setting. The main attraction of Cala Galdana is its pristine beach, which stretches for approximately 300 meters and boasts crystal-clear turquoise waters. The beach is crescent-shaped, with fine golden sand that gently slopes into the sea, making it ideal for families and swimmers of all ages. The calm and shallow waters also make it a popular spot for snorkeling and other water activities.
